What are the qualities, traits, experience and/or skills you consider in order to be a good DJ?

A good DJ is someone who has a broad range of knowledge in music - artists and songs, they should also have a strong background in music that is required and essential for Weddings. The DJ should play the popular songs or songs that the client has requested as opposed to songs he/she favours. A good DJ should be able beat-match but it is not necessary that he/she needs to mix 100% of the event/show. The DJ should have some knowledge of equipment. What steps can I take as a bride/groom to book a reliable DJ?

Do your research. Browse the web, shop around, visit bridal shows and call references. Bridal shows are just for information and to see what companies are out there. DJ companies simply just pay approximately $1400.00 and they have themselves a booth. So being a DJ at a bridal show alone does not mean they are reliable or good. The DJ or DJ company should have a website, pictures from past events, perhaps some videos or a portfolio. Most importantly, a great personality!

More tips on booking a DJ/Wedding DJ

Choose the right DJ for your event or wedding. Compare different options and do your research in person, online and on the phone. Ask your friends or family for advice. They may have hired a DJ so they have experience and knowledge of which DJs are good or what to look out for. Fill out contact forms on different DJ's websites and see who contacts you first. Obviously choose a DJ that interests you. The DJ should be in touch with you shortly to answer any questions or make suggestions to you. He or she should also advise you as to whether or not he/she is available to DJ at your event/wedding. It is always great if you let the DJ know about your event including the number of people, age group, location, song style, your expectations, itinerary, whether you need lights or an MC, etc. The more information you provide the DJ, the better. We understand that finding the right DJ can be challenging and that's why we are trying to help. The perfect DJ for you depends on your requirements. Watch videos and view photos from the DJs website to see the DJ in action. Be sure to read testimonials from those who have hired the DJ in the past and who have left useful feedback about their experiences. This should provide you with some piece of mind. Book early because you may need to book 6 or even 12 months in advance. Get a contract and read it carefully. Most professional wedding DJs will also require a deposit in order to secure them. Don't be scared to pay the deposit. Follow up with your wedding DJ as often as you can or need to. Don't be shy about making sure your disc jockey knows exactly what you want. Most DJs want to know all the details as they rather avoid surprises. Ask if you can send a song-list and ask the DJ if he/she can play from it and/or take requests. Be sure to include songs your guests may want to hear. You can also include songs you absolutely don't want to hear.
